Beyond Replacement: A Technical Performance Leap
While the IRF3808PBF is a proven workhorse with its 75V, 140A rating and 7mΩ RDS(on) at 10V gate drive, the VBM1803 builds upon this foundation for superior efficiency and current handling. Featuring a compatible 80V drain-source voltage and the industry-standard TO-220 package, it delivers critical advancements:
Lower Conduction Losses: The VBM1803 achieves a remarkably low on-resistance of just 3mΩ at a 10V gate drive. This represents a dramatic reduction of over 57% compared to the IRF3808PBF's 7mΩ, translating directly into significantly higher system efficiency and cooler operation.
Higher Voltage & Current Capability: With an increased drain-source voltage of 80V and a massive continuous drain current rating of 195A, the VBM1803 offers substantially greater design headroom and robustness compared to the original's 75V and 140A. This provides engineers with enhanced flexibility and confidence for demanding high-current applications and challenging operational conditions.
Quantifiable Efficiency Gain: According to the conduction loss formula P = I² x RDS(on), at a 100A load, the VBM1803 reduces power dissipation by more than half compared to the IRF3808PBF. This drastic reduction in heat generation can simplify thermal management, reduce system size, and boost overall reliability.
Where It Excels: Application Benefits
The technical superiority of the VBM1803 translates into tangible benefits across its target applications:
High-Current DC-DC Converters & Power Supplies: In synchronous rectification or as a primary switch, the ultra-low RDS(on) minimizes conduction losses, enabling higher efficiency and power density to meet stringent energy standards.
Motor Drive Systems: For industrial motors, automotive systems, and heavy-duty tools, the combination of extremely low resistance and high current rating ensures minimal heat generation during start-up, stall, and high-torque conditions, leading to superior efficiency and durability.
Power Distribution & Inverters: The high 195A current and 80V voltage rating support more compact, reliable, and higher-power designs for applications like uninterruptible power supplies (UPS), inverters, and battery management systems.
